What is Virtu Financial's restricted cash?
Virtu Financial (VIRT) reported restricted cash of $56.98M in Q1 2026.
How has Virtu Financial's restricted cash changed year-over-year?
Virtu Financial's restricted cash increased by 20.3% year-over-year, from $47.36M to $56.98M.

What does restricted cash mean?
Cash restricted for specific purposes by contractual, regulatory, or legal requirements — not available for general corporate use.
